VisitDarling is a wine region in South Africa, home to 18 producers tracked on Femente, 1 of them rated 90+ on the critic index. Its vineyards are led by Shiraz/Syrah, Cabernet Sauvignon, and Merlot, producing South African Syrah and South African Sauvignon Blanc wines with notes of Oak, Black fruit, and Red fruit. It takes in Groenekloof.
Darling — good to know
- What grape varieties are grown in Darling?
- The most planted varieties in Darling are Shiraz/Syrah, Cabernet Sauvignon, Merlot, and Sauvignon Blanc, based on the wines Femente tracks across the region.
- What wines is Darling known for?
- Darling is known for South African Syrah, South African Sauvignon Blanc, and South African Cabernet Sauvignon wines and flavors of Oak, Black fruit, and Red fruit.
- How many wineries are in Darling?
- Femente tracks 18 producers in Darling, of which 1 are rated 90+ on the critic index.
- Where is Darling?
- Darling is a wine region in South Africa, taking in Groenekloof.
